Central European University (CEU) is seeking a highly committed professional with experience of archival practice, senior management, with a deep familiarity of memory institutions, and a broad range of demonstrated interests in the humanities and the social and information sciences to lead the Blinken OSA Archivum.

The Blinken OSA Archivum is a unique organization. As an integrated part of CEU, the Archivum is a repository of important documents, as well as an educational and research hub for public activities. The focus of its mission is to support research and public engagement in topics related to the Cold War, Communism, Human Rights, the history of the recent past, as well as central policy issues of the present.
